3 hours ago, Bird Bird Bird said:

 

Are you saying that international roaming is free ? 

The basic pack where you don't get to send sms, make/receive call. Only thing allowed is receiving sms via roaming.

That is free. I have not paid even on prepaid for last 2 trips to US/EU.

So here it is.

 

My first miles redemption and damn, it has been a frustrating journey (more on that below) but the reward makes up for all of it and a lot more (gonna be a bit long).

 

- Context:

A couple months ago I started looking for DEL-JFK/BOS Biz class award tickets, for travel in one of the busiest seasons of the year.

 

Pre-Christmas week.

 

Should have started earlier but plans weren't concrete and the window of travel was quite short.

It was going to be a long shot since availability on this sector and season goes by in a flash, generally requiring bookings to be made a year in advance.

As expected, except AI, availability was practically non-existent (better to travel economy than AI).

Some LOT or UK/TK (mixed cabin) were sprinkled here and there but none of the premium cabins and none in the week I targeted.

 

Was doing at least 1 search across all of the major FFPs every other day, taking extensive time and effort.

 

Targets were mid-level cabins of LH/LX (there was no way anything premium was going to open up) and initially had slight hope of bagging a last minute flight as per the ongoing pattern.

This meant that I would likely have to keep investing time into searches and even then, only be able to get a confirmed booking days before departure.

 

- The spiral:
As soon as June began, the last minute availability stopped showing up. UA was dry. 

Season was turning out to be one of the most gruesome, even the most seasoned miles experts were at a loss.

Was meant to only get tougher.

Pent up demand and miles brokers were to blame.

 

All of my potential plans were ruined, had no hope of finding anything worthwhile, gave up on the award hunt.

Investing so much time into this, only to end up forking out the money from my own pocket, led to unparalleled disappointment.

 

On top of it, Axis forced everyone to make a move. Transferred 80k to QR to diversify.

Directionless transfer, had no intention of using these anytime soon.

Still once in a while, I used to run quick searches on AA (for QR) and on UA/TK/AP but always ended giving up mid-way.

 

- The clutch:

3 days ago, one of the members of a Credit Card Discord I am part of, mentioned that AA has stopped showing QR J availability.

Did not think much of it first but later I found it to be a bit weird, for ages AA has been the go to searching & booking tool for QR J (for the west).

The move looked odd.

 

Decided to do quick searches directly on QR and found nothing. Repeated the next day and found nothing yet again.

 

Then today, came across a post mentioning that QR has added a new daily for DOH-JFK. Did not give much attention but later had some free time in office, so decided to give it another try.

 

AND JACKPOT!

 

Not only DOH-JFK, got DEL-DOH-JFK QR J, that too QSUITES, on multiple days (starting 15th Dec). Got one on Dec 21st.

Instantly flipped international transactions on CC and booked it.

 

Could not believe it. Expected the booking to be a glitch and to be cancelled.

From losing all hope and expecting to pay up to getting one of the best (if not the best) J cabin available, in the busiest season possible.

Qatar Biz lounge at Doha awaits!

 

Conclusion: Going to be travelling QR J this Christmas. Thanks to actual CC/AV geek knowledge. No 5% cashback card could have ever provided this.

 

Supplementary:

- Costed 80k QR miles (Avios) and 22k in taxes.

- Similar QR J going for 2.4-2.8L, giving value of 2.725-3.225 Rs/mile (post deducting taxes)

- This was possible because of a multitude of factors, I did put in time and effort but majorly came down to luck.

- The reason AA stopped showing QR J was because AA removed their own DOH-JFK flight and QR saw the opportunity and added another daily.

AA removed QR to not promote the better and cheaper option while the new flight wasn't even listed on revenue, reducing visibility.

- Had miles in QR (because of Axis) and could book ASAP, otherwise it would have taken ages for points to transfer and by then availability would have gone by. It already has, all lapped up.

- UA: United, UK: Vistara, TK: Turkish, LH: Lufthansa, LX: Swiss, AI: Air India, AA: American, QR: Qatar, LOT: Lot Polish, J: Business Class
